2-bedroom cabin getaway nestled on 11 acres in the heart of the Manistee National Forest. Private Beach Access On Big Star Lake.

Ride right from the cabin to Snowmobile/ATV/ORV Trails. Hiking Trails, Fly Fishing, Boating, Marquette Trails Golf Course, and Entertainment all within 10 minutes! Float down the Pere Marquette River or spend the day at the beach!

The cabin is perfect for 5 people or fewer. The cabin is equipped with WiFi and Roku!

Come for a weekend or spend a week surrounded by everything Michigan has to offer!
